A French bronze striking mantel clock, late 19th century
The case in the form of a Grecian lamp, with female figural handle stoking a flame with an arrow, on oval base raised on toupie feet, the white enamel Arabic dial signed CHARLES DUPONT PARIS, the twin barrel movement with platform lever escapement and strike on bell -- 15in. (38cm.) high
